Bhanurekha Ganesan
- Born:
- October 10, 1954, Madras (now Chennai), Tamil Nadu, India
- Nationality:
- Indian
- Profession(s):
- Actress, Dancer
Early Life and Education
- Daughter of Tamil actor Gemini Ganesan and Telugu actress Pushpavalli.
- Began her film career at a young age to support her family.
- Initially had limited formal education due to her early entry into acting.
Career and Major Achievements
- Made her debut as a child artist in the Telugu film Rangula Ratnam (1966).
- Acted in over 180 Hindi films throughout her career.
- Known for her versatility and transformation from a young, unpolished actress to a sophisticated performer.
- Received significant acclaim for her performances in films like Umrao Jaan (1981), Khoon Bhari Maang (1988), and Silsila (1981).
- Won a National Film Award for Best Actress for her role in Umrao Jaan.
- Received several Filmfare Awards throughout her career.
- Considered one of the most influential and successful actresses in Indian cinema.

Legacy and Impact
Bhanurekha Ganesan, popularly known as Rekha, has had a profound and lasting impact on Indian cinema. Her ability to reinvent herself and deliver memorable performances across various genres has solidified her status as a legend. Her fashion sense and enigmatic persona have also made her a cultural icon.
